LB150 series:Large binoculars with a 150mm large aperture objective. It has a high market share in astronomical observations due
to its ability to collect light and analyze images. This is Fujifilm's world's highest-end large binoculars. Its nighttime light
collection ability is particularly outstanding, and many astronomers use the LB150 as their important collection to observe the
trajectory of the comet. Its lenses are EBC coated with a high resolution image, and the edges of the lens are also available in
distortion-free, color-free, translucent and sharp images. In addition, it has a waterproof structure and corrosion resistance,
and can be widely used in fishing, shipbuilding, and observation and monitoring in harsh environments.
electronic beam coating:Fujifilm's multi-layer coating further enhances light transmission.

ED lens:Due to the size of the large binoculars, it is necessary to use a short focal length objective lens, and it is more and
more difficult to compensate for the significant secondary spectrum (magnification chromatic aberration) as the magnification
increases. Fujinon Telescope uses special ED lenses in 25X150ED, 40X150ED, and 25X150EM. Successfully suppressed the color edge
phenomenon to the limit.
